Persistence changes the model

Air pollution, earnings and firm productivity are persistent. A dynamic panel may write

Yit=ρYi,t1+τDit+αi+λt+εit.Y_{it}=\rho Y_{i,t-1}+\tau D_{it}+\alpha_i+\lambda_t+\varepsilon_{it}.

After within transformation, the demeaned lagged outcome is correlated with the demeaned error in a short panel. This is the source of Nickell bias; adding a lag to a fixed-effects regression is not innocuous.

First differences move, not remove, the problem

Differencing gives

ΔYit=ρΔYi,t1+τΔDit+Δλt+Δεit.\Delta Y_{it}=\rho\Delta Y_{i,t-1}+\tau\Delta D_{it} +\Delta\lambda_t+\Delta\varepsilon_{it}.

αi\alpha_i disappears, but ΔYi,t1\Delta Y_{i,t-1} contains εi,t1\varepsilon_{i,t-1} and is correlated with Δεit\Delta\varepsilon_{it}. Arellano–Bond-style methods use deeper lags as instruments under restrictions on serial correlation and initial conditions.

Instrument proliferation can overfit endogenous variables and weaken specification tests. Report instrument count, lag choices and sensitivity; more instruments are not automatically better.

Dynamic causal effects are not one coefficient

A clean-air policy can have:

  • anticipation before formal adoption;
  • an immediate traffic response;
  • gradual fleet replacement;
  • displacement to neighbouring areas;
  • persistence after reversal.

Define treatment history Dˉit\bar D_{it} and the horizon-specific contrast. A contemporaneous coefficient τ\tau may mix these processes or impose a constant effect that the policy question does not need.

Unbalanced panels and attrition

Units may leave because firms close, pupils migrate or records fail. Fixed effects do not correct selective observation.

Audit:

  1. entry and exit by treatment history;
  2. outcome availability at every intended horizon;
  3. whether treatment changes observation;
  4. balanced-panel and inverse-probability sensitivity;
  5. bounds under plausible missing outcomes.

Restricting to a balanced panel can itself condition on survival.

Quick check

A five-year panel includes lagged earnings and worker fixed effects. Why might the treatment coefficient still be biased?

Answer
The transformed lag is correlated with transformed errors in short panels; treatment may respond to past shocks; lagged earnings may be post-treatment; attrition and measurement error may remain. The exact threat depends on the timeline and target effect.
